Troyer Spelling Variations

Spelling variations of this family name include: Troye, Troyye, Troyes, Troys, Troyee, Trooye, Troyyes, Troyye, Troyys, Troy, Troyers and many more.

Troyer Ranking

In the United States, the name Troyer is the 6,780th most popular surname with an estimated 4,974 people with that name. [1]

Contemporary Notables of the name Troyer (post 1700) +

  • Verne J. Troyer (1969-2018), American stand-up comedian, actor, stuntman and performer, best known for playing Mini-Me in the Austin Powers film series, one of the shortest men in the world
  • Maynard Troyer (b. 1938), American retired NASCAR Winston Cup Series driver
  • Eric Lee Troyer (b. 1949), American keyboardist and singer/songwriter
  • Carlos Troyer (1837-1920), American composer
  • Warner Troyer (1932-1991), Canadian broadcast journalist and writer
